It has been public knowledge that Amitabh has had a long-standing fight against a liver ailment. After his accident during the shoot of Coolie movie, the actor contracted Hepatitis B and struggled with health-related issues for a long while. Over the period, Amitabh Bachchan lost about 75% of his liver to cirrhosis. Later he was also told that his liver was infected. The actor, however, has managed to stay fit through medical treatments as well as a healthy lifestyle.

A muscle dysfunctional disorder

According to reports, the actor suffered various ailments shortly after his Coolie incident. Amitabh was diagnosed with Myasthenia Gravis, which is a muscle dysfunctional disorder. This condition makes it difficult for the ailing person to perform basic tasks such as brushing teeth, picking up things, walking, etc. The doctors also said that the actor recovered from this condition but it can trigger anytime. 

Severe Diverticulitis of the small intestine

As per the reports, the actor also suffered gastro issues which later converted into diverticulitis of the small intestine. The doctors revealed that was a rare occurrence and could prove to be fatal if not attended on time. This ailment can be solved with antibiotics. But Bachchan's was a severe case that led to his operation in 2005.

Forthcoming Projects

The megastar celebrated his birthday on October 11, 2019. On the professional front, Amitabh Bachchan has Brahmastra, Gulabo Sitabo, Jhund and Chehre in his pipeline. Among these, Nagraj Manjule’s Jhund will be released first. Based on the life of Vijay Barse, the film stars Akash Thosar and Rinku Rajguru alongside Bachchan. Produced under the banners of Tandav Films, T-Series and Aatpaat, the biographical sports drama is scheduled to theatrically release on December 13, 2019.
